What Are Fryd Carts?


Fryd Carts are unregulated, disposable THC vape pens that gained popularity on the black market for their potent highs, candy-like flavors, and low prices. However, they are not sold in licensed dispensaries, meaning they lack safety testing, legal oversight, and quality control.



???? Key Facts About Fryd Carts (2025)


✔ Black Market Status – No legitimate company sells them; most are copyright.
✔ High THC Content – Often contain delta-9, delta-8, or synthetic cannabinoids.
✔ No Lab Testing – Risk of pesticides, heavy metals, and vitamin E acetate.
✔ Legal Risks – Banned in multiple states, with potential felony charges.







❌ Why Fryd Carts Are Dangerous


1. Fake or Contaminated Ingredients




  • Many contain unknown cutting agents (like vitamin E acetate, linked to vaping lung injuries).




  • Some copyright versions have synthetic THC (K2/Spice), which can cause seizures or psychosis.




2. No Quality Control




  • Mislabeled potency (some batches are 10x stronger than others).




  • Fake packaging – Many replicas flood the market.




3. Legal Consequences




  • Federal crime to ship across state lines (trafficking charges).




  • Banned in strict states (e.g., Idaho, Kansas, Nebraska).








???? Most Common Fryd Cart Questions (2025)


1. Are Fryd Carts Legal?




  • No. They are not sold in licensed dispensaries and often exceed legal THC limits.




2. Will Fryd Carts Fail a Drug Test?




  • Yes. Most contain delta-9 THC, which triggers standard drug tests.




3. Where Are Fryd Carts Sold?




  • Black market only (dealers, shady smoke shops, Telegram, Snapchat).




4. What Are the Best Flavors?




  • Popular ones include Banana Runtz, Strawberry Cough, and Gelato—but flavor ≠ safety.




5. Can You Travel with Fryd Carts?




  • Extremely risky. TSA and law enforcement can confiscate them or press charges.
